CM8 3XG, encompassing the village of Wickham Bishops in Essex, is a small residential cluster with a population of 2,086 spread across 206 people per square kilometre. Nestled east of the Blackwater River, the area rises to 77 metres, offering elevated views and a distinct character shaped by its history. The village’s name traces back to the Domesday Book, reflecting its medieval roots as a dwelling place linked to the Bishop of London. Today, it balances heritage with modern convenience, with St Bartholomew’s Church standing as a focal point. Daily life here is defined by a quiet, rural atmosphere, with proximity to Maldon and Witham providing access to services while retaining a village feel. The area’s low population density and historic buildings, such as Wickham Hall and Hill Place, contribute to its charm. Residents benefit from nearby rail links and a network of local shops, making it appealing for those seeking a peaceful yet connected lifestyle. The community, predominantly home-owners in family-sized houses, reflects a stable demographic with a median age of 47, suggesting a mix of long-term residents and families.
